MATCH REPORT: Frank Kalanda Penalty Takes Express FC Back To League Summit.

Express FC picked up their fourth home league win of the season after their 1 – 0 win over Busoga United on Friday 5th March at the Betway Muteesa II stadium Wankulukuku.

Forward Frank Kalanda who was making his first start since Senkaaba got injured scored from 12 yards in his second straight game in the 25th minute to ensure the maximum points.

Eric Kambale’s clever play to win the penalty was a big catalyst to our win.

The Red Eagles started on the back foot with Busoga controlling the game especially with creating chances, Issa Lumu was caught napping on a few occasions but Murushid Juuko was on hand to save the situation.

The moment of truth came in the 24th minute when Erick Kambale was tripped by Busoga United goalkeeper Omedwa Rogers leaving centre referee Shamila Nabadda with no option but to point to the spot, Frank Kalanda stepped up and converted his 4th of the season and his second in consecutive games. The action summed up the first period.

Frank Kalanda beat Omedwa from the spot to give us all three points.

After recess, the visitors probed the Red Eagles but Mathias Muwanga was at hand to keep his 6th clean sheet of the season.

For Wasswa Bossa, a win is all that is required especially in a situation where games are coming in thick and fast.

REACTIONS.

Wasswa Bossa – Head Coach.

Wasswa Bossa’s team is now unbeaten in 12 games with only 3 remaining to conclude the first round.

“The games come in thick and fast and as you can see, it’s taking a toll on the players but I am glad that the boys are responding, today wasn’t any different but the most important thing is we got the 3 points, a league is a marathon so onto the next”.

Abel Etrude – Midfielder.

“We managed to grind out the result, the games are coming in think and fast but as players we know we have very good fitness coaches and I am sure the technical team will do a fantastic job to ensure all the players are fit”.

The win takes Express FC back to the top of the log on 28 points, one ahead of second placed Vipers S.C.

Issa Lumu has been an important part of our defense since matchday two after replacing suspended captain Enock Walusimbi. Express now has the best defense in the league conceding only 6 games in 12 games.
